quote:

A redemption story that took 7 seasons to mature. He went from a villain to a top 5 character. 


Jaime never fully redeemed. In fact he never really redeemed himself at all.

He tried on redemption the way you might try on a shirt. He wore it around awhile, found it didn't fit and took it off.

I forget what episode it was but there was a point in this "redemption tour" of his where he laid siege to a castle and threatened to catapult children and babies over the wall......And he meant it. That's who his character really is.

He never lied about what and who he was, all the way up to the end with brianne and also when he told tyrion in his last scene with him that he basically didn't care what happened to the people of kings landing and that he didn't like them.

Jaime's circle with Cersei to me, was the best part of this episode. He knew where he belonged.
